## Runbook: Retiring the homegrown queue

So we're finally killing off Stackrabbit, the in-house job queue, in favor of Drayline. The tricky bit: Stackrabbit workers poll a shared table, while Drayline pushes jobs over a broker, so anything that assumed at-least-twice delivery (yes, really) needs idempotency keys now. Drain Stackrabbit first, confirm the table is empty, then flip the feature flag. Don't run both consumers at once or you'll double-charge something. Drayline reads its connection settings from the values below.

deployment values, kagef-hahap:
wenael:
  log_level: warn
  metrics_host: metrics.wenael.qorvelsys.internal
  pin: 3768
  pool_size: 32

TURN-208: Gatevale turnstile counters at the Merrow Field pilot double-count when a rotation reverses mid-cycle. Attendance totals drift roughly 2% high per event. The debounce window fix is implemented, reviewed by Ilsa, and soak-tested across two simulated match days without drift. Ready for your cut; the candidate build is identified below.

trace token, tagag-tafog: htk6_5ed18c

Ticket #— Floor 9 Opening Prep, Brindlemoor House

Hi facilities folks, Floor 9 opens to staff next Monday and we need a few things squared away before then. Lift access is live, but the two side doors by the kitchenette are still on the old lock config — please reprogram them before Friday. Also, signage for the quiet rooms hasn't arrived, so pop up the temporary printed ones for now. Until the badge readers sync, the interim door code for Floor 9 is below.

door code, bajop-bajog: bdg-DSWAC-43621

☐ Off-site run: master copies to Inkwell & Sons print shop. Grab the grey folio case from the office manager's cabinet — it's got the only clean masters of the Fairmont brochure set, so treat it like gold. Case stays zipped, no photocopying stops on the way, and don't leave it in the van while you grab coffee. Courier from Dovett Runners is booked for 13:15 at the side entrance. When they arrive, pass along the following instruction word for word.

handover note for yagef-bagep: the drudor pelius courier leaves the kasdor zorvan norir ledger at gate 8016 under passcode 755406